A horrific crash in Orange County earlier today proved fatal for the driver of one of the eight vehicles involved. According to KABC News, the accident happened at the intersection of Harbor Boulevard and Valencia Mesa Drive, across from St. Jude Medical Center. Reportedly, the driver of a Ford pickup truck was driving at a high rate of speed going the wrong way on Harbor Boulevard. Seven other vehicles were involved in the spectacular crash. The preliminary reports indicate it was the truck driver who was killed in the accident that sent at least five other people to local hospitals. The precise cause of the collision is still under investigation, and the nature of the injuries sustained by the surviving victims is currently unknown.
Scene of the Accident
The area of the accident is on a stretch of roadway that passes right in front of St. Jude Medical Center and the St. Jude Medical Plaza. This stretch of Harbor Boulevard is relatively flat and straight, with no apparent obstructions for drivers traveling in either direction on Harbor Boulevard. Given the devastation apparent in the photograph of the accident, there can be little doubt that at least one of the vehicles involved in this accident was traveling at a high rate of speed. Assuming the initial reports are correct, much of the accident investigation is likely to focus on the "wrong-way" driver and why he was traveling on the wrong side of the road and at such a speed. Whenever a driver inexplicably drives on the wrong side of the road and at what appears to be an excessive speed, authorities generally consider the possibility of driver intoxication or impairment to be the most likely cause, until proven otherwise.
When compared to cities of similar size, Fullerton ranks as one of the more dangerous in the State, according to the California Office of Traffic Safety. This is particularly true for accidents involving drivers who had been drinking, regardless of their age.
